Is Bessemer, AL a Good Place to Live?
Bessemer receives an overall livability grade of C+ (56/100), suggesting room for improvement compared to other areas in Alabama. Safety scores C+ (52/100). Affordability scores C+ (54/100) with a median household income of $57,783 and median home values around $152,467.
About 21.1% of resid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and the unemployment rate is 7.2%. 72% of housing is owner-occupied. The median age is 40.
